// Licensed to the .NET Foundation under one or more agreements. // The .NET Foundation licenses this file to you under the MIT license. using System; using System.Collections.Generic; using System.Diagnostics.CodeAnalysis; using System.Threading; using System.Threading.Tasks; namespace Microsoft.Extensions.VectorData; /// <summary> /// Represents a vector store that contains collections of records. /// </summary> /// <remarks> /// <para>This type can be used with collections of any schema type, but requires you to provide schema information when getting a collection.</para> /// <para>Unless otherwise documented, implementations of this abstract base class can be expected to be thread-safe, and can be used concurrently from multiple threads.</para> /// </remarks> public abstract class VectorStore : IDisposable { /// <summary> /// Gets a collection from the vector store. /// </summary> /// <typeparam name="TKey">The data type of the record key.</typeparam> /// <typeparam name="TRecord">The record data model to use for adding, updating, and retrieving data from the collection.</typeparam> /// <param name="name">The name of the collection.</param> /// <param name="definition">The schema of the record type.</param> /// <returns>A new <see cref="VectorStoreCollection{TKey, TRecord}"/> instance for managing the records in the collection.</returns> /// <remarks> /// To successfully request a collection, either <typeparamref name="TRecord"/> must be annotated with attributes that define the schema of /// the record type, or <paramref name="definition"/> must be provided. /// </remarks> /// <seealso cref="VectorStoreKeyAttribute"/> /// <seealso cref="VectorStoreDataAttribute"/> /// <seealso cref="VectorStoreVectorAttribute"/> [RequiresDynamicCode("This API is not compatible with NativeAOT. For dynamic mapping via Dictionary<string, object?>, use GetDynamicCollection() instead.")] [RequiresUnreferencedCode("This API is not compatible with trimming. For dynamic mapping via Dictionary<string, object?>, use GetDynamicCollection() instead.")] public abstract VectorStoreCollection<TKey, TRecord> GetCollection<TKey, TRecord>(string name, VectorStoreCollectionDefinition? definition = null) where TKey : notnull where TRecord : class; /// <summary> /// Gets a collection from the vector store, using dynamic mapping; the record type is represented as a <see cref="Dictionary{TKey, TValue}"/>. /// </summary> /// <param name="name">The name of the collection.</param> /// <param name="definition">The schema of the record type.</param> /// <returns>A new <see cref="VectorStoreCollection{TKey, TRecord}"/> instance for managing the records in the collection.</returns> public abstract VectorStoreCollection<object, Dictionary<string, object?>> GetDynamicCollection(string name, VectorStoreCollectionDefinition definition); /// <summary> /// Retrieves the names of all the collections in the vector store. /// </summary> /// <param name="cancellationToken">The <see cref="CancellationToken"/> to monitor for cancellation requests. The default is <see cref="CancellationToken.None"/>.</param> /// <returns>The list of names of all the collections in the vector store.</returns> public abstract IAsyncEnumerable<string> ListCollectionNamesAsync(CancellationToken cancellationToken = default); /// <summary> /// Checks if the collection exists in the vector store. /// </summary> /// <param name="name">The name of the collection.</param> /// <param name="cancellationToken">The <see cref="CancellationToken"/> to monitor for cancellation requests. The default is <see cref="CancellationToken.None"/>.</param> /// <returns><see langword="true"/> if the collection exists, <see langword="false"/> otherwise.</returns> public abstract Task<bool> CollectionExistsAsync(string name, CancellationToken cancellationToken = default); /// <summary> /// Deletes the collection from the vector store. /// </summary> /// <param name="name">The name of the collection to delete.</param> /// <param name="cancellationToken">The <see cref="CancellationToken"/> to monitor for cancellation requests. The default is <see cref="CancellationToken.None"/>.</param> /// <returns>A <see cref="Task"/> that completes when the collection has been deleted.</returns> public abstract Task EnsureCollectionDeletedAsync(string name, CancellationToken cancellationToken = default); /// <summary>Asks the <see cref="VectorStore"/> for an object of the specified type <paramref name="serviceType"/>.</summary> /// <param name="serviceType">The type of object being requested.</param> /// <param name="serviceKey">An optional key that can be used to help identify the target service.</param> /// <returns>The found object, otherwise <see langword="null"/>.</returns> /// <exception cref="ArgumentNullException"><paramref name="serviceType"/> is <see langword="null"/>.</exception> /// <remarks> /// The purpose of this method is to allow for the retrieval of strongly typed services that might be provided by the <see cref="VectorStore"/>, /// including itself or any services it might be wrapping. For example, to access the <see cref="VectorStoreMetadata"/> for the instance, /// <see cref="GetService"/> can be used to request it. /// </remarks> public abstract object? GetService(Type serviceType, object? serviceKey = null); /// <summary> /// Disposes the <see cref="VectorStore"/> and releases any resources it holds. /// </summary> /// <param name="disposing"><see langword="true"/> if called from <see cref="Dispose()"/>; <see langword="false"/> if called from a finalizer.</param> protected virtual void Dispose(bool disposing) { } /// <inheritdoc/> public void Dispose() { Dispose(disposing: true); GC.SuppressFinalize(this); } }
